MBA-Master of Business Administration

The MBA Program is a postgraduate degree that provides students with highly specialized skills and advanced knowledge in business management and leadership. The courses and subjects included in an MBA program favour the use of practical applications and case studies, which ultimately prepare graduates for leadership roles in various industries. Admission for MBA courses and programs is based on the entrance exam and is considered when a GD, WAT, and PI have been completed.

Some of the best management colleges are:

1. IIM Ahmedabad

IIM Ahmedabad is the best B-school in India, offers a variety of courses such as digital strategy, leadership, economic policies, business analytics, game theory, and pre-MBA accounting. The fee for the program is from INR 25.5 to 36 lakhs. Admission for Indian students is based on the CAT exam and GMAT.

2. IIM Bengaluru

IIM Bengaluru is one of India’s top business schools and offers courses like Accounting for Decisions, Corporate Finance, Marketing Management, Economics for Managers, Operations Management, Macroeconomics, Multivariate Data Analysis, and Optimization. The average program fee is about INR 26 lakhs, and only one exam is mode for admission, that is the CAT (Common Admission Test).

3. IIM Calcutta

IIM Calcutta is based in West Bengal and is a well-known, sought-after business school in India. It has a variety of courses such as Managerial Communication, Managerial Skill Development, Decision Making Tools, Marketing, and Financial Analysis. The course fee starts from 23.2 to 25 lakhs, and the entrance exam is the CAT (Common Admission Test).

4. IIM Lucknow

IIM Lucknow is one of the top business schools in India, located in Uttar Pradesh. IIM Lucknow is a newly built college in Indian management education, as compared to IIM Ahmedabad, IIM Calcutta, and IIM Bengaluru. IIM Lucknow offers management courses such as Organizational Behaviour, Financial Accounting, Managerial Economics, Corporate Finance, and Human Resource Management. The program fee starts from INR 16.28 lakhs to 36.2 lakhs. Admission is done through CAT.

5. IIM Kozhikode

IIM Kozhikode (Indian Institute of Management Kozhikode) is a business school in Kerala and is one of the most popular business schools in India. The IIM Kozhikode offers program courses like Organization and Market Economics, Organizational Behaviour, Data Analysis, Business Communication, Marketing Management, and the Economic Environment, etc. The average fee for the MBA program is INR 20.5 lakhs. They only accept the CAT Exam.

6. Faculty of Management Studies (FMS)

FMS Delhi is located in New Delhi,  has been one of the best MBA colleges in India. It charges extremely low fees for quality education and excellent placement in comparison to other B-schools of its category. FMS Delhi offers courses and subjects such as Organizational Behaviour, Managerial Economics, Financial Accounting, Marketing Management, Business Communication, Business Strategy, etc. The total MBA fees amount to about INR 2.29 Lakh, and admission is through the CAT exam.

7. Indian School of Business, Hyderabad & Mohali

ISB(short for the Indian School of Business) is a private business school in Hyderabad and Mohali. ISB offers a regular MBA program with courses such as Public Policy, Learning & Management, Business Markets, Analytical Finance, Healthcare, and Global Manufacturing. The average fee a student pays is around INR 49.5 lakhs, and students are selected on the basis of GMAT or GRE Scores.

8. IIM Indore

IIM Indore is located in Madhya Pradesh and is the best IIMs and a top business school in India. The Institute offers Courses in Marketing, Economics, Strategy, Organizational Behaviour, Accounting, and Communication. The fee structure ranges from INR 21.17 lakh to 31.17 lakh for an MBA. Admission is based on the CAT exam or the IIM Indore IPMAT exam.

9. MBA ESG, India

MBA ESG is a school of business with campuses in Paris, Bengaluru, and Pune, ranked in the top 20 in Europe and the top 4 in India. MBA ESG specializes in the courses: Luxury & Fashion Management, Data Science & Artificial Intelligence, International Business, Fintech Management, International Marketing & Branding, and Sports Management. The average fee is approximately INR 15 lakhs. Admissions depend on the college’s own entrance examination.

10. SP Jain Institute of Management and Research, Mumbai

SP Jain Institute was established in 1981 and is located in Mumbai, one of the best business schools in India. The institute offers a range of courses like Contemporary Marketing, Logistics and Supply Chain, Consulting, Technology and Finance, Organizational Behaviour, Managerial Economics, Financial Accounting, etc. The average fees range from INR 9.5 lakhs to INR 23 lakhs. The entrance exams for admission to this college are CAT and GMAT. They also have their entrance exam called SPJAT (SP Jain Aptitude Test).

IIMs Admission Process 2026

The Admission process at IIM is essentially three separate stages. The following is a brief overview of the three stages of the IIM admission process:

Stage 1: Shortlisting of candidates based on their CAT exam score

A new role for candidates in the WAT/GD-PI stage is created only after the results of the CAT exam are declared. The relevant notification is published on the websites of different IIMs. Candidates who are at or above the cut-off for the shortlist must submit their academic credentials and CAT score by logging in with their CAT IDs.

Stage 2: Selection of candidates for WAT/GD-PI

The second stage is the process whereby the applicants for the WAT/GD-PI are short-listed depending on their CAT score and grades. Next, the interview letters are sent to the selected candidates for a WAT-GD-PI round. Such a round takes place in a number of cities between February and April.

Stage 3: Derivation of Composite Score and Final Selection

The last stage in the IIM entrance is the determination of each candidate’s composite score from a variety of parameters that lead to final selection.

Eligibility Criteria For Management Colleges

The eligibility criteria for MBA programmes at IIMs are identical to the eligibility criteria for CAT, which is 50 percent aggregate marks in graduation. Anyone eligible to take the CAT will be eligible for admission to the IIMs as long as they meet some additional selection criteria. Here are the IIM eligibility criteria:

  • The minimum IIM eligibility criteria are a Bachelor’s Degree with an aggregate of a minimum. 50 percent marks or equivalent Cumulative Grade Point Average (CGPA) (45 percent in case of SC, ST, and PWD/DA categories).
  • Candidates in the final year of a bachelor’s degree/equivalent qualification, or who have appeared in the final examination for the degree/equivalent qualification, or candidates waiting for results, are eligible to apply.y

FAQs

Which is the No.1 MBA college in India?

IIM Ahmedabad is widely considered the No.1 MBA college in India due to its academic excellence, global reputation, and high placement packages.

What entrance exams are required for admission to these colleges?

Most top MBA colleges accept CAT (Common Admission Test). Some also accept GMAT/GRE (ISB, SPJIMR), while specific institutes may have their own exams like XAT (XLRI) or SPJAT (SPJIMR).

What is the average fee for top MBA colleges in India?

Fees vary across institutes. IIMs typically charge between INR 20–36 lakhs, ISB Hyderabad charges around INR 49.5 lakhs, while FMS Delhi is very affordable at around INR 2.3 lakhs.
